Transaction 878289f2bc869e46f7e5e697fb74a241fc8d3862d85d51a9e79b99863264ddb3

1 Input
2 Outputs
  • 878289f2bc869e46f7e5e697fb74a241fc8d3862d85d51a9e79b99863264ddb3:0
  • value  3465400
    address  1KfXFDjPyStz33RWmFfXccDdpWChpbh6Lw
  • 878289f2bc869e46f7e5e697fb74a241fc8d3862d85d51a9e79b99863264ddb3:1
  • value  657018
    address  161bmepgvE7ut1wnPJrRvUe58vYrFFHL2b